Overview

This document provides a comprehensive service manual for Panasonic Inverter Air Conditioners, specifically models CS-HZ9RKE-1, CS-HZ12RKE-1, CS-HZ9RKE-5, and CS-AZ9RKE-1 for indoor units, and CU-HZ9RKE-1, CU-HZ12RKE-1, CU-HZ9RKE-5, and CU-AZ9RKE-1 for outdoor units, designed for North Europe.

Function Description

The air conditioner utilizes Inverter Technology, which offers a wider output power range, enhanced energy saving, quick cooling and heating, and more precise temperature control. It is designed to operate with R32 refrigerant, a non-ozone depleting substance with a lower global warming potential compared to conventional refrigerants.

Key operational improvements include a Quiet mode to reduce indoor unit operating sound, a Powerful mode for rapid room temperature adjustment, and a 24-hour timer setting. A unique "+8/15°C Heat Operation" feature provides heating at low temperature settings, ideal for protecting unoccupied houses and appliances from extreme cold during winter.

The unit incorporates various quality improvements such as random auto restart after power failure, gas leakage protection, prevention of compressor reverse cycle, an inner protector for the compressor, and noise prevention during soft dry operation. For ease of maintenance, it includes a Breakdown Self-Diagnosis function.

Important Technical Specifications

The air conditioners operate on a single-phase 230V, 50Hz power supply.

Cooling Performance (CS-HZ9RKE-1 / CS-HZ9RKE-5 / CS-AZ9RKE-1):

  • Capacity: 0.85 kW (Min), 2.50 kW (Mid), 3.00 kW (Max)
  • EER (W/W): 5.00 (Min), 5.49 (Mid), 4.48 (Max)
  • SEER (W/W): 7.8, Class A++
  • Annual Consumption: 112 kWh
  • Indo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 39/25/20 dB-A
  • Outdo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 46/-/43 dB-A

Cooling Performance (CS-HZ12RKE-1):

  • Capacity: 0.85 kW (Min), 3.50 kW (Mid), 4.00 kW (Max)
  • EER (W/W): 5.00 (Min), 4.22 (Mid), 4.04 (Max)
  • SEER (W/W): 7.6, Class A++
  • Annual Consumption: 161 kWh
  • Indo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 42/28/20 dB-A
  • Outdo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 48/-/45 dB-A

Heating Performance (CS-HZ9RKE-1 / CS-HZ9RKE-5 / CS-AZ9RKE-1):

  • Capacity: 0.85 kW (Min), 3.20 kW (Mid), 6.65 kW (Max)
  • COP (W/W): 5.15 (Min), 5.61 (Mid), 3.78 (Max)
  • SCOP (W/W): 5.2, Class A+++
  • Annual Consumption: 808 kWh
  • Indo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 44/24/18 dB-A
  • Outdo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 47/-/44 dB-A

Heating Performance (CS-HZ12RKE-1):

  • Capacity: 0.85 kW (Min), 4.20 kW (Mid), 7.75 kW (Max)
  • COP (W/W): 5.15 (Min), 5.00 (Mid), 3.41 (Max)
  • SCOP (W/W): 5.1, Class A+++
  • Annual Consumption: 1043 kWh
  • Indo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 45/25/18 dB-A
  • Outdoor Noise (H/L/QLo): 50/-/47 dB-A

Common Specifications:

  • Refrigerant Type: R32, with a Global Warming Potential (GWP) of 675.
  • Precharged Amount: 1.12 kg (39.5 oz)
  • Pipe Diameter (Liquid / Gas): 6.35 mm (1/4") / 9.52 mm (3/8")
  • Standard Piping Length: 5.0 m (16.4 ft)
  • Maximum Piping Length: 20 m (65.6 ft)
  • Maximum I/D & O/D Height Difference: 10.0 m (32.8 ft)
  • Compressor Type: Hermetic Motor (Rotary), Brushless (4 poles)
  • Indoor Operation Range: Cooling (16-32°C DB, 11-23°C WB), Heating (16-30°C DB)
  • Outdoor Operation Range: Cooling (16-43°C DB, 11-26°C WB), Heating (-20-24°C DB, -20-18°C WB)

Usage Features

The air conditioner is controlled via a remote control, offering various settings such as operation mode (Cool, Dry, Heat, Fan), fan speed, air swing, and temperature adjustment. The remote control also features a "Check" button for self-diagnosis and clock setting.

The indoor unit includes an indicator panel with LEDs for Power, Timer, +8/15°C Heat, Deice, Powerful, Quiet, and ECONAVI modes, providing visual feedback on the unit's status. An Auto OFF/ON button on the indoor unit allows basic operation even if the remote control is misplaced or malfunctioning.

ECONAVI operation utilizes a sunlight sensor to detect intensity and differentiate between sunny, cloudy, or night conditions, optimizing energy saving by adjusting the temperature. The sensitivity of the sunlight sensor can be adjusted.

Maintenance Features

The manual emphasizes safety precautions for servicing, especially when dealing with R32 refrigerant, which is slightly flammable. Only qualified personnel should install or service the product. Special tools for R32 refrigerant piping and flare nuts are required, and copper pipes must have a thickness of more than 0.8 mm.

The self-diagnosis function displays alphanumeric error codes (e.g., H11 for indoor/outdoor abnormal communication, F91 for refrigeration cycle abnormality) to assist in troubleshooting. The remote control can be used to display memorized error codes, and there's a procedure to clear these codes after repair.

The manual provides detailed instructions for:

  • Installation: Selecting the best location for both indoor and outdoor units, fixing the installation plate, drilling piping holes, and connecting cables.
  • Refrigerant Piping: Using appropriate pipe materials, processing and connecting pipes (cutting, flaring, brazing), and ensuring proper evacuation of the system using a vacuum pump.
  • Refrigerant Recovery and Re-insertion: Procedures for safely recovering refrigerant and re-inserting new refrigerant in the correct amount.
  • Brazing: Detailed guidance on preparation for brazing, adjustment of vacuum pump pressure, checking gas provision, flame adjustment, types of flame, and selection of brazing materials. Nitrogen gas flow is recommended during brazing to prevent oxidation.
  • Troubleshooting: Flowcharts for diagnosing various error codes and malfunctions, including checks for power supply, sensor abnormalities, fan motor issues, communication errors, and refrigerant cycle problems.
  • Disassembly and Assembly: Step-by-step instructions for removing and assembling indoor unit components (front grille, electronic controller, discharge grille, control board, cross flow fan, indoor fan motor) and outdoor unit electronic controller.

Regular maintenance includes checking air filters, ensuring proper drainage, and verifying the cleanliness of heat exchangers to maintain optimal performance and prevent malfunctions.
